Parker Rochford has started this season in the same fashion he closed his All-America effort a year ago. The Wartburg junior safety has earned American Rivers Conference and national recognition the first two weeks with four interceptions, three pass breakups and 14 total tackles for the No. 3-ranked Knights.

Dominic Shepardson owns multiple Coe football records and ranks among the program’s best pass catchers in a few more categories. He is coming off a career day with 182 yards and four touchdowns on seven receptions in a 56-6 season-opening victory over Cornell, earning a spot on D3football.com’s Team of the Week.
